After 2 years of raising chickens, I just realized I was giving them way too much protein

I kept wondering why my hens were laying weird soft shells and some were getting aggressive with each other. Took them to the vet last month and she asked what I was feeding them. I was giving them a 26% protein feed because I thought more protein meant better eggs. She told me that's way too high for most backyard flocks unless you have roosters or meat birds. Switched to a 16% layer feed and within a week the shells got harder and the pecking order calmed down. Anyone else get bad advice from the feed store guy who just wants to sell the expensive stuff?
